0

Railアーキテクチャについて混乱していると思いますが、ここに私の質問があります:

次のような構造の Java の REST サービスがあります。

GET  scores/class/elementeray_class/teacher/miss_teacher/highschool

次にHAML view、Rails にクラス名、教師名などの値を入力するテキスト ボックスがたくさんあるとしましょう...

次にcontroller 、Rails コントローラーで Java REST サービスに NetHTTP 呼び出しを行い、値を取得して、その JSON を HAML ビューに戻して新しいデータを表示できるようにします。

したがって、2 つのことが a:あります。ユーザーが HAML ビューで選択した値をコントローラーで読み取れるようにする必要があります。 b:(a) からこれらの値を読み取った後、上記の Java REST が必要とする URL を形成できるはずなので、それを呼び出して JSON を取得できます。

そして、これら(a)と(b)を達成する方法は一日中私を混乱させました.誰かがそれを高レベルで説明できますか?

4

1 に答える 1

1

フォームが送信する POST パラメーターは、コントローラーからアクセスできる params[] ハッシュに Rails が入れるものです。次に、コントローラーでビューをレンダリングしたり、別のアクションにリダイレクトしたりできます。

公式ドキュメントのこの簡単なチュートリアルに従うことをお勧めします。1 時間以内に Rails アーキテクチャを使い始めることができます。

http://guides.rubyonrails.org/getting_started.html

于 2013-06-27T19:56:48.367 に答える